How To Fix /SAPAPO/DM_VERS_MGMT100 - Error when accessing user interfaces


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SAPAPO/DM_VERS_MGMT -

  • Message number: 100

  • Message text: Error when accessing user interfaces

    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/DM_VERS_MGMT100 typically relates to issues with version management in S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O). This error can occur when there are problems accessing or managing the data versions in the system, particularly when using user interfaces like the SAP GUI or web interfaces.

    Cause:

    1. Version Management Issues: The error may arise if there are inconsistencies or issues with the version management settings in APO.
    2. Authorization Problems: Users may not have the necessary authorizations to access certain versions or data.
    3.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the master data or transaction data that the version management relies on.
    4. System Configuration: Incorrect configuration settings in the APO system can lead to this error.
    5. Transport Issues: If recent changes were transported to the system, they may not have been properly implemented or could have introduced errors.

    Solution:

    1. Check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the version management functionalities. This can be done by checking the user roles and authorizations in the SAP system.
    2. Review Version Management Settings: Go to the version management settings in APO and verify that they are correctly configured. Check for any inconsistencies or errors in the version data.
    3. Data Consistency Check: Run consistency checks on the master and transaction data to identify and resolve any inconsistencies that may be causing the error.
    4. System Logs: Check the system logs (transaction SLG1) for any additional error messages or warnings that could provide more context about the issue.
    5. Transport Management: If the error occurred after a transport, review the transport logs and ensure that all necessary objects were transported correctly.
    6. SAP Notes: Search for relevant SAP Notes in the SAP Support Portal that may address this specific error. SAP frequently releases notes that provide fixes or workarounds for known issues.
    7. Consult Documentation: Review the official SAP documentation for version management in APO to ensure that all settings and configurations are correct.
